Vestas gets 54 MW Eurowind Energy order in Denmark

Anela DoksoBy Anela Dokso01/10/20202 Mins Read
Share
LinkedIn Twitter Facebook Email WhatsApp Telegram

Vestas has secured a 54 MW order for the GreenLab Skive project from Eurowind Energy. 

The GreenLab project, located in Mid Jutland, Denmark is a sustainable energy park and research facility that generates renewable energy from multiple sources such as wind, solar and biogas.

To maximize the project’s power production, Vestas has developed a site-specific wind energy solution that features one V126-3.45 MW turbine delivered in 3.6 MW Power Optimised Mode and 12 V136-4.2 MW turbines, combined with towers on different hub heights and a 20-year Active Output Management 5000 (AOM 5000) service agreement.

“We are happy to execute this landmark project in Denmark together with Vestas and thus strengthening our cooperation with Vestas even further. This hybrid project – with wind, solar and storage battery – will supply green power directly to a 12 MW hydrogen/E-methanol production facility making the green transition really happening through sector coupling.”

Jens Rasmussen, CEO of Eurowind Energy.

“We are proud to deliver our technology to a lighthouse project like GreenLab, which works to transform the way green energy is produced, converted, stored and put to use. GreenLab truly marks a significant step in making the energy transition come true.

“At the same time, we look forward to implementing yet another wind project with Eurowind Energy and utilizing the flexible 4 MW platform technology for the benefit of our valued customer”.

 Nils de Baar, president of Vestas Northern & Central Europe.

The contract further includes supply, installation and commissioning of the wind turbines, as well as a VestasOnline Business SCADA solution, lowering turbine downtime and thus optimizing the energy output.

Deliveries and commissioning are expected to begin in the second quarter of 2022.
